The General Overseer of the Alive Chapel International Bishop Elisha Salifu Amoako has disclosed that some musicians are working to destroy Shatta Wale.

According to the prophet, the musicians have taken Shatta Wale to Benin to 'bring him down' him with 'juju'.

Bishop Amoako made the disclosure during one of his prophecy sessions in his church.

In an audio recording of the prophecy which has been heard by YEN.com.gh, the 'man of God' indicated that he was taken into Shatta Wale's room in spirit.

And the Lord told him that He was going to protect Shatta Wale from his enemies and make a prophet later in life.

Bishop Amoako further indicated that five Ghanaian musicians had sent Shatta Wale to Benin to 'destroy' his voice and bring him down but God had protected.

Amoako added that God told him that He had protected Shatta Wale since he was only 12 years old and will continue to protect him.

The prophecy ended with Amoako stating that Shatta Wale will make more money than any other artiste in Ghana this year 2021.
